ITV'S DATING SHOW "LET LOVE RULE" LANDS IN THE UK

The successful format was commissioned by ITV2 and has reached the third country since its launch earlier this year.

ITV Studios’ reality dating format "Let Love Rule" reaches its third country, as ITV2 in the UK has commissioned the show with the local title "The Cabins". The British adaptation will be produced by 12 Yard, part of ITV Studios, and is slated to run in 2021 in the primetime slot.

The show is a huge success in the Netherlands, where SBS6 is currently broadcasting the second series of 103 episodes following the first 110. In Sweden, TV4 has recently acquired the show for both their VOD platform TV4 Play and their linear channel Sjuan.

Paul Mortimer, ITV’s Head of Digital Channels and Acquisitions says: “This is a fantastic new format which challenges couples to leave their devices at home and attempt to date face to face, with no distractions.  We’re thrilled to be bringing this show to the ITV2 viewers who will have front row seats watching our couples as they attempt to find true love.” 

Maarten Meijs, President Global Entertainment, ITV Studios adds, “It is amazing to see the great success of 'Let Love Rule', that brings a unique take to the popular dating genre. With its global appeal and local relevance, the show has the scale and can be produced locally, in line with the current Covid-19 protocols. We are very happy to bring this exceptional dating format to the UK. We believe ITV2 is the perfect home for it, given its positioning and proven success in this genre.”

This is the first major commission for 12 Yard under the new management team of Managing Director Michael Mannes and Creative Director Liz Gaskall, who took over the reins at the label earlier this year.

Says Michael Mannes, Managing Director 12 Yard, “We are delighted ITV2 have commissioned the series and can't wait to get into full production on what we hope will be a big hit with this exciting new twist on the reality dating format.”
